Baron Davis Bio

Baron Davis is an American former professional basketball player born in Los Angeles, California on April 13, 1979. He is a two time NBA All-Star and currently works as a studio analyst for The NBA on TNT. He started playing basketball from a young age and played high school basketball at Crossroads School in Santa Monica. While playing basketball in high school he was named Gatorade National Player of the Year and was selected to play in McDonald’s All-American High School Basketball Game in Colorado Springs. He went on to play college basketball at UCLA and was named the Pac-10 Freshman of the Year. In 1999 he declared for the 1999 NBA draft and was picked third overall by the Charlotte Hornets. Throughout his career he has played for a number of professional teams, including the New Orleans Hornets, the Golden State Warriors, the Los Angeles Clippers, the Cleveland Cavaliers, the New York Knicks, and the Delaware 87ers. His professional career spanned from when he was drafted in 1999 to 2016. Over those 17 years he scored 13,447 points, had 6,025 assists, and 1,530 steals. In 2017 he became a regular panelist for the NBA on TNT’s show Players Only.
